About Hamdullah Yanık
Hamdullah Yanık is a scholar working on Oncology, Immunology, Molecular Biology, Biomaterials and Infectious Diseases, having authored 13 papers that have together received 312 indexed citations. Recurring topics across this work include Nanoparticle-Based Drug Delivery (3 papers), Immune Cell Function and Interaction (2 papers), SARS-CoV-2 and COVID-19 Research (2 papers), Immune cells in cancer (2 papers), Pancreatic and Hepatic Oncology Research (2 papers), Immunotherapy and Immune Responses (2 papers), Advanced Drug Delivery Systems (2 papers) and S100 Proteins and Annexins (1 paper). The work is most often cited by research in Biomaterials (71 citations), Immunology (63 citations), Pharmaceutical Science (19 citations), Oncology (69 citations) and Molecular Medicine (11 citations). Hamdullah Yanık has collaborated with scholars based in Türkiye, United States and Spain. Frequent co-authors include Güneş Esendağlı, Süleyman Can Öztürk, Ece Tavukçuoğlu, Kerim Bora Yılmaz, Adem Şahin, A. Yekta Özer, Mine Silindir‐Gunay, Murat Tuncel, Makbule Aydın and Sevgi Önal. Their work appears in journals such as Scientific Reports, European Journal of Pharmaceutical Sciences, Journal of Drug Delivery Science and Technology, European Journal of Pharmaceutics and Biopharmaceutics and Immunology.
